1. A right circular cone and a right circular cylinder have equal base and equal height. If the radius of the base and the height are in the ratio 5 : 12, then the ratio of the total surface area of the cylinder to that of the cone is :

Solution:
Let their radius and height be 5x and 12x respectively
Slant height of the cone,
l=(5x)2+(12x)2=13x
Total surface area of cylinderTotal surface area of cone=2πr(h+r)πr(l+r)=2(h+r)(l+r)=2×(12x+5x)(13x+5x)=34x18x=179Or17:9
